UV Protection Technologies for Solar Power Plant Cable Assemblies

Solar power plants operate in harsh outdoor environments where cable assemblies are continuously exposed to ultraviolet (UV) radiation, extreme temperatures, and weather fluctuations. UV exposure is particularly damaging, causing insulation degradation, cracking, and premature failure of cables, which can compromise power transmission efficiency and system safety. The Critical Need for Safety in Mining Operations The mining industry faces unique electrical hazards due to flammable gases, combustible dust, and volatile atmospheres. Traditional cabling systems pose ignition risks, accounting for 12% of mining accidents globally (Mine Safety Institute, 2024). Explosion-proof cables emerge as a transformative solution, engineered to prevent spark propagation even in catastrophic failure scenarios. As global temperatures rise and extreme weather events become more frequent, industries worldwide are rethinking infrastructure design to withstand environmental challenges. Among these innovations, ​climate-proof cables are emerging as a critical component in modern engineering, offering enhanced durability and reliability in harsh conditions.
